The Public Water Features
The Public Water Features Villages and villages relied on practical water fountains to channel water for cooking, bathing, and cleaning from nearby sources like ponds, channels, or creeks. In the years before electric power, the spray of fountains was driven by gravity alone, usually using an aqueduct or water resource located far away in the surrounding mountains. Typically used as memorials and commemorative edifices, water fountains have inspired men and women from all over the globe throughout the centuries. When you see a fountain at present, that is definitely not what the first water fountains looked like.
Created for drinking water and ceremonial purposes, the 1st fountains were very simple carved stone basins. The earliest stone basins are presumed to be from around 2000 BC. The spraying of water appearing from small spouts was forced by gravity, the only power source designers had in those days. The location of the fountains was influenced by the water source, which is why you’ll commonly find them along aqueducts, canals, or streams. Fountains with embellished Gods, mythological monsters, and creatures began to show up in Rome in about 6 B.C., crafted from rock and bronze. Water for the communal fountains of Rome was brought to the city via a intricate system of water aqueducts.
